The North Penn football team looks to bounce back from its first loss while Pennridge is out to remain undefeated and top the Knights for the first time since 2012 Friday night.
Kickoff for the Suburban One League National Conference clash at Pennridge’s Helman Field is set for 7 p.m.
The Rams hold the top spot in the District 1-6A rankings after posting a 14-0 road shutout against Pennsbury in their conference opener last Friday.
Ryan Rowe ran 13 times for 126 yards and a touchdown, scoring from four yards out in the second quarter to give Pennridge all the points it needed. Michael Ferguson added a 10-yard TD run in the third as the Rams reached 4-0 for the first time since 2020.
